Hello, I have a problem with desctop Vivaldi on Windows 10 Pro.
Actions I perform
- Open Vivaldi browser, open 10+ tabs
- Send Windows Pro to hibernate
- Wake up OS from hibernate
- Reopen Vivaldi browser and work again for some time
- Restart OS (but do not close Vivaldi manually)
- Open Vivaldi browser after restart
What is expected
Vivaldi automatically restores tabs after waking up from hibernate and after restartWhat is really happening
Vivaldi is normally restoring tabs after hibernate. Even if you close the browser.
Vivaldi opens only one blank tab with speed dial after OS restart. Even if you pinn the tab.There is no settings that can set up this behavior so I think this is a bug.
It's really annoying because Windows restarts system by itself when update is comming and you must manually restore all the tabs you need for your work afterwards.Vivaldi "About" tab data:

Path to profile C:\Users\User\AppData\Local\Vivaldi\User Data\DefaultI've solved the problem.
I'm not sure but I think there is some issue with profile directory access rights when Vivaldi is installed in "only for me" mode.
After OS restart session data in profile dir was epmty (no Current* or Local* files at all).I've reinstalled it for "all users" (and manually set installation dir to C:\Program Files (x86)\Vivaldi) and it started to restore sesion after OS shutdown.
